I am sure I messed up somewhere during the process, but I can't set it
srtaight now. Please help. THE PROBLEM: Whenever I double click on any folder
in the right side window on the Windows explorer it open a search window,
instead of exploring the folder itself. Please help me set it
right.......Please be gentle.....give me explanation easy steps.....like to a
6th grader.

Click Start, Run and type this command:

regsvr32 /i shell32.dll
